Interesting Facts
- West Virginia University at Parkersburg is the only state community college in West Virginia accredited to offer bachelor's degrees. It is one of only 34 public institutions in the country classified as a baccalaureate/associate college.
- With more than 40 programs of study, WVU Parkersburg offers a wide variety of programs from certificates to bachelor’s degrees. Such programs include welding, surgical technology, business administration, elementary education, criminal justice and 3-D modeling.
- WVU Parkersburg has developed career ladders to ensure that students can move easily from one degree level to another. Competencies are gained at every successive step in the ladder to prepare students for more demanding and higher paying occupations.
